Summary

Some North African countries are busy targeting doctors and journalists for speaking out about their government’s handling of coronavirus instead of focusing on fighting the virus. Egypt has been struggling since before the pandemic hit, and now its government’s crackdown on media and activism about coronavirus is further stressing the country. FOX’s Trey Yingst speaks with Amy Hawthorne, the Deputy Director for Research at the Project on Middle East Democracy, on just how far Egyptian President Al-Sisi will go to contain information from citizens.
